Recap

The episode kicks off with Angelina and Adrian on Flight 828. 

In the present day, she's with the 828ers plotting to save themselves. 

They planned to expose the NSA and takedown Mick and Ben before they destroyed everything. 

Grace was reeling from Cal's disappearance. Gupta assured her this meant they had more information about the dark lightning, but Grace was being a mom and begged them to return the tail fin into the ocean. 

Everyone at the NSA refused, and Commander Zimmer overruled Vance and ordered them to keep running tests on the tail fin. 

Each test brought more seismic activity including earthquakes and dark lightning. 

Grace went home to grab Cal's sketchbook to see if maybe he drew the answer of where they should dump the tail fin. 

Olive discovered there was a drawing underneath the original, which Gupta recognized as a message to her meaning grandmother.

She immediately became a believer, turned on Zimmer, and helped them locate where they should dump the tail fin, which ended up being right in the heart of an electrical storm. 

Vance explained that he got the Coast Guard to agree to take them there. 

On their way, Vance was forced to retreat because the 828ers were planning an attack on his home. 

Eagan and Randall took his son hostage. 

Mick, Zeke, Drea, and Jared responded to the situation. 

Jared and Vance went inside to mitigate the situation. When they saw an opportunity, they subdued the men and saved his son.

Jared questioned if Vance had anything to do with The Major's murder after seeing a picture of him and his army buddy, but Vance ignored the question. 

Finally, Jared confronted Mick asking about Vance and Saanvi's involvement. She owned up to it, and Jared accused her of quitting the force to cover up a murder. 

He then told her he didn't want to be involved with the Callings anymore, explained he had to end things with Sarah because he wouldn't base his relationship on a lie, and professed his love for Mick. 

Zeke heard and felt all of it and told Mick that they had to talk. 

Meanwhile, Ben and Saanvi steered the ship right into the electrical storm, but before they could dump the tail fin, the captain informed them they were turning around as they got orders from above. 

Saanvi couldn't let this moment go by as she knew she was responsible, so she ran out onto the deck and attempted to cut the tail fin loose. 

While she was doing that, she fell overboard and was crushed by the tail fin. Ben jumped in to rescue her and watched the tail fin glow and disappear. 

He saved Saanvi. They both got a Calling and found themselves back on Flight 828. Mick was there and saw Adrian with bloody hands warning of a murder. 

Cal was also in his seat and informed them that he had to go and this is the way it had to be. 

He then disappeared. 

Mick found the book Angelina was holding on the original flight and realized that something bad was happening in the Stone home. 

Back at the house, Angelina broke in, locked Olive in her room, stabbed Grace, baptized Eden, and kidnapped her. 

Grace lay on the ground bleeding to death when she saw an aged Cal, who came to say goodbye and told his mother he knew what he had to do now. 

Gupta was leaving Eureka when she heard a whirring sound. She turned around to see Captain Daly in the captain's seat. He said "help me" before disappearing with the reconstructed plane.
